Understanding House Edge and Fairness
The house edge is the mathematical advantage that ensures a casino profits over time, typically expressed as a percentage of each bet. For every wager you place, this built-in margin dictates the casino’s statistical share, but it doesn’t guarantee an immediate loss. Understanding this concept helps you separate engaging gameplay from unfair rigging. True fairness in gambling hinges on Random Number Generators (RNGs) and learn more certified audits that verify outcomes are genuinely random. A low house edge, combined with transparent rules, gives you a fairer shot at winning sessions. Savvy players seek games with these characteristics, recognizing that the edge is the cost of entertainment, not a scam. By mastering the balance between risk, reward, and game fairness, you elevate your experience from mere luck to strategic play.
Random Number Generator Certification
The house edge is the mathematical advantage a casino or gambling platform holds over players, calculated as a percentage of total bets retained over time. This built-in margin ensures the operator profits in the long run, regardless of individual outcomes. Fairness, in turn, refers to the integrity of the game’s mechanics—ensuring outcomes are random and unmanipulated. For digital games, provably fair algorithms use cryptographic hashing to let players verify each result independently. Key factors in understanding this balance include:
- Edge calculation: Derived from game rules (e.g., roulette’s zero pocket vs. odds offered).
- Verification: Open-source code or third-party audits confirm RNG randomness.
- Transparency: Sites publishing house edge percentages and audit reports.
Q: Can the house edge be zero? A: Only in skill-based betting (e.g., poker) with no rake; otherwise, edge is always positive for the house.

Strategies for Responsible Play
Responsible play hinges on establishing clear boundaries before engaging. A core strategy involves setting a strict budget and time limit in advance, treating any potential loss as the cost of entertainment rather than an investment. Players should never chase losses, as this often leads to poor decisions. It is equally crucial to maintain emotional detachment, stopping play when feeling frustrated or intoxicated. Additionally, taking regular breaks provides perspective. For those who struggle with self-control, using deposit limits or self-exclusion tools offered by platforms can be effective. Ultimately, setting personal limits before starting is the most reliable safeguard against problematic behavior.
